About this role

Job Goal: The Parent Coordinator works in collaboration with the school principal and staff to actively engage families in the school community. This role is focused on building and maintaining strong partnerships among families, teachers, students, and community organizations to support student achievement and well-being. Qualifications:

• Minimum of 48 college credit hours or a passing score on the ParaPro Assessment.

• Bilingual with proficiency in speaking, reading, and writing (Spanish preferred).

• Strong communication, organizational, interpersonal, and problem-solving skills.

• Experience working with diverse populations and understanding their needs.

•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ications and general computer skills.

• Flexible schedule, including availability for early mornings, evenings, and weekends.

Performance Responsibilities:

• Act as a liaison between families and school staff, including social workers, teachers, and administrators.

• Translate oral and written communications for parents.

• Make phone calls and conduct home visits as necessary.

• Schedule and coordinate translators for parent-teacher conferences.

• Communicate student and family needs and concerns with appropriate school staff.

• Collaborate with the principal to plan and organize family engagement events such as:

• Open House / Back-to-School Picnics

• Math and Reading Nights

• Parent Information Workshops (e.g., state testing, academic support, technology use)

• Parent classroom visits and school lunches

• Monthly student recognition assemblies

• Partner with local community agencies to connect families with support services and resources.

• Work with school leadership to review and revise the School Parent Engagement Policy and School-Parent Compact annually.

• Conduct parent surveys to help determine family engagement goals and improve programming.

• Promote a welcoming, inclusive school environment for all families.

• Perform other duties as assigned by the building administrator(s).

Working Conditions:

• School-based environment with regular interaction with students, parents, and staff.

• Requires travel within the district and occasional home visits.

• Extended hours during events or busy periods.
